India’s Tourism

What is the size of India´s tourism industry, and what do you make of its potential?
The total inbound tourism to India is about 2.4 million. Maybe this year it will reach 2.5 or 2.6 million. The outbound tourism is about 4.6 million, about double of the inbound. Inbound tourism is very important for India—it generates foreign exchange, a lot of employment, and it is one industry with a minimum requirement in terms of investment..

But are these attractions generating the number of tourists they should be?
The tourism volume is not there for some reasons, and the primary reason is air-seat capacity. Ninety-five percent or 98 percent of the people who come to India arrive by air. Now the total air seat capacity of India is around five and a half million—that is, five and a half going and five and a half coming, altogether 11 million seats. That is not enough to take care of tourist and non-tourist traveller to and from India.
